We may define line as:
- A line is a straight one-dimensional figure having no thickness and extending infinitely in both directions.
- A line is sometimes called a straight line.
- It is demonstrated by arrow on both sides showing that it can be extended on both sides.
- A line can be considered undefined term because it tells us about something that does not have width or depth.
- A lines can extend its length in both side infinitely. It contains arrowheads indicating it can extend.
